Pet Insurance: Caring for Pets with Financial Protection

Pet insurance is a type of insurance that helps pet owners manage the cost of veterinary care. Pets, like humans, can suffer from illnesses, accidents, and unexpected health issues. Pet insurance provides financial support so that owners can focus on their pet’s well-being without worrying about high medical expenses.

What Is Pet Insurance?

Pet insurance is a contract between a pet owner and an insurance company. The owner pays a regular premium, and the insurer covers certain veterinary expenses as outlined in the policy. These expenses may include treatments for accidents, illnesses, surgeries, medications, and sometimes routine care.

Types of Pet Insurance

Common types of pet insurance include:

  • Accident-Only Insurance: Covers injuries caused by accidents.
  • Accident and Illness Insurance: Covers both injuries and diseases.
  • Comprehensive Pet Insurance: May include wellness care such as vaccinations and regular checkups.
